How Does Deep Cleaning Improve Indoor Air Quality and Carpet Longevity?
Deep cleaning improves indoor air quality by physically removing particulates and biological residues from the carpet pile and upper padding, which otherwise become reservoirs for allergens. The extraction process lifts dust mites, pollen, and microscopic grit that continuously resuspend into household air when disturbed, so removing them reduces airborne exposures and allergy triggers. Removing abrasive soil also prevents microscopic fiber breakage that accelerates matting and color loss, which keeps carpets looking newer for longer. Regularly scheduled professional extraction therefore combines immediate air-quality gains with longer-term cost avoidance through preserved carpet condition.
Why Is Eco-Friendly Carpet Cleaning Important for Duluth Families and Pets?
Eco-friendly carpet cleaning reduces the risk of chemical residue, inhalation exposures, and skin irritation for children and pets while still delivering deep extraction results. Many conventional detergents leave residues that attract re-soiling or irritate sensitive individuals; biodegradable, non-toxic solutions avoid that trade-off. Using low-residue formulations with hot water extraction provides effective soil removal without lingering surfactants, supporting healthier indoor air and safer post-cleaning re-entry times. How Does ATL Clean’s Advanced Steaming Method Work for Deep Carpet Cleaning?
Advanced steaming, also called hot water extraction, cleans by applying heated water with cleaning solution under pressure, agitating fibers, and immediately extracting the suspension to remove soil, allergens, and residues. The combination of heat, mechanical agitation, and high-volume extraction breaks bonds between soil and fibers, then removes both liquids and suspended solids with minimal leftover residue. Effective steaming includes pre-treatment of problem areas, calibrated rinse cycles when needed, and controlled drying to avoid overwetting. This method balances deep cleaning power with safety and is especially effective for pet stains, heavy clay soils, and allergen reduction.
Professional steaming follows clear steps that produce reliable results:
- Inspection and pre-treatment: Identify fiber types and pretreat stains or high-traffic areas.
- Hot water application and agitation: Apply heated cleaning solution and agitate to loosen embedded soils.
- High-volume extraction: Remove water and suspended solids using powerful extractors.
- Rinse and speed-dry: Rinse if required and use air movers or absorbency techniques to reduce drying time.
These stages explain why hot water extraction is preferred for deeply soiled or allergen-laden carpets, and why it typically outperforms dry or low-moisture techniques for full remediation.
The table below compares hot water extraction with common alternatives to clarify suitability.
| Approach | Typical Residue | Drying Time | Best Use |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hot water extraction | Minimal when rinsed | 4–6 hours with air movers | Deep soil, allergens, pet stains |
| Dry/encapsulation | Low residue but may leave soil | 30–60 minutes | Light maintenance, fast turnaround |
| Low-moisture | Low water use, potential residue | 30–120 minutes | Quick fixes, not deep extraction |
This comparison shows the trade-offs: hot water extraction removes the most soil and allergens, while dry methods prioritize speed but may leave residues behind.

What Is Hot Water Extraction and Why Is It the Best Method?
Hot water extraction uses heated water and mechanical suction to dissolve and remove soils and residues that adhere to carpet fibers and padding, providing deep cleaning beyond surface vacuuming. Heat and agitation loosen biological matter and oily soils while high-volume extraction removes both liquid and suspended particles, reducing allergen reservoirs and improving fiber resilience. Compared to dry methods, extraction reduces residual cleaning agents that can re-attract dirt and cause rapid re-soiling; that makes it superior for homes with pets, children, or frequent outdoor soils like red clay. How Much Does Professional Carpet Cleaning Cost in Duluth, GA?
Cost for professional carpet cleaning varies with service scope because providers price on factors like square footage, stain severity, pet treatments, and additional services rather than a single flat fee. Key drivers include the number and size of rooms, the presence of persistent odors or urine that require enzyme or specialized treatments, any required furniture moving, and whether supplementary services like upholstery cleaning or sanitizing are bundled. Local conditions such as frequent pollen seasons or red-clay tracking can increase cleaning frequency and thus annual maintenance costs. Understanding these factors helps homeowners get transparent estimates and choose the best-value option for their needs.
Common pricing factors to consider:
- Carpet size and number of rooms: Larger areas increase labor and equipment time.
- Condition and stain severity: Heavy soil or pet urine requires additional treatments.
- Add-on services: Deodorizing, upholstery cleaning, and carpet repair add to total cost.
Recognizing these components enables better comparisons between providers and helps avoid surprise charges.

How Can You Effectively Remove Pet Odors and Stains from Carpets in Duluth?
Persistent pet odors and stains require a multi-step professional approach because surface cleaning often masks rather than eliminates odor sources that have penetrated fibers and padding. Professional treatment identifies contamination depth, uses enzyme-based chemistry to break down organic residues, extracts the dissolved material, and applies neutralizers that eliminate odor rather than covering it. Aftercare includes controlling re-soiling and addressing behavior or preventative measures to avoid recurrence. For durable results, professionals combine precise chemistry with thorough extraction and follow-up inspection.
Pet odor and stain removal follows a clear procedural workflow:
- Inspection and detection: Find all affected areas, including hidden spots and padding penetration.
- Pre-treatment: Apply targeted cleaners to loosen residues and break down organic matter.
- Enzyme treatment and dwell time: Use enzyme solutions that digest urine compounds instead of masking smells.
- Extraction and neutralization: Thoroughly extract treatment residues and apply neutralizers to remove lingering odors.
This sequence explains why enzyme-based professional work is more permanent than surface cleaners or masking deodorizers.
What Causes Persistent Pet Urine Odors in Carpets?
Urine penetrates carpet fibers into padding and sometimes into subflooring, where bacteria break down urea into ammonia and other odorous compounds that persist until the source is fully removed. Surface cleaning often leaves behind urine salts and byproducts that continue to emit odor, and repeated soiling can set stains and deepen penetration. Identifying depth of contamination is therefore essential to selecting an appropriate remediation strategy that reaches padding or subfloor when necessary. That is why professional inspection and targeted enzyme treatments are recommended for persistent cases.
